Description:
This is an online racing game set in the wilderness, where players can control the acceleration to experience the thrill of being a racing master. Click on the accelerator to control the speed and immerse yourself in the game.
Embed this game on your MySpace or on your Website:
Barbie, Dress-Up, Fashion, Makeover
Play